幻影之瞳
浏览量1220    |    粉丝1    |    关注0
  • 幻影之瞳

    幻影之瞳

    2025-12-02 10:29:02
    Web Storage使用指南_localStorage与sessionStorage的区别
    localStorage持久存储且同源共享,适合用户偏好;sessionStorage仅限当前会话,适合临时数据;两者均遵循同源策略,API相同但作用域与生命周期不同。
    220
  • 幻影之瞳

    幻影之瞳

    2025-12-02 10:39:06
    JavaScript图算法实现_javascript复杂计算
    图算法在JavaScript中通过邻接表或矩阵表示,适用于社交网络、导航等场景,结合DFS、BFS、Dijkstra等算法可高效处理路径与关系问题。
    319
  • 幻影之瞳

    幻影之瞳

    2025-12-02 15:53:02
    文件上传功能实现_处理大文件分片上传
    分片上传通过将大文件切块实现高效稳定传输。1.前端利用FileAPI按5MB切片,生成唯一标识并携带元信息上传;2.后端接收后存入临时目录,记录分片状态;3.支持断点续传,前端跳过已传分片,服务端校验哈希并合并;4.优化包括唯一标识、大小限制、重试机制、进度显示及临时文件清理,确保稳定性与性能。
    449
  • 幻影之瞳

    幻影之瞳

    2025-12-02 16:15:19
    VSCode语言服务器协议_实现智能代码补全
    LSP是微软提出的标准化协议,使VSCode通过与语言服务器通信实现跨语言智能补全;当用户输入时,编辑器发送上下文信息至服务器,后者解析语法树并返回候选列表,最终由编辑器渲染提示;开发者可借助LSP库注册补全回调、解析源码并返回符号建议,结合上下文感知、排序过滤与增量更新优化体验。
    539
  • 幻影之瞳

    幻影之瞳

    2025-12-02 17:17:59
    javascript_如何实现继承机制
    JavaScript继承基于原型链,ES6的class为语法糖。1.原型链继承通过子类prototype指向父类实例,实现方法共享,但引用属性共用有污染风险;2.构造函数继承利用call调用父构造函数,实现属性独立,但无法继承原型方法;3.组合继承结合两者优点,既通过call继承实例属性,又通过原型链继承方法,是传统方式中最推荐的;4.ES6Class继承使用extends和super,语法清晰,语义明确,底层仍基于原型,是现代开发首选方案。
    858
  • 幻影之瞳

    幻影之瞳

    2025-12-02 17:31:32
    JavaScriptTC39标准_JavaScript语言规范解读
    TC39通过五阶段流程推动JavaScript发展,确保语言在兼容基础上持续进化,近年引入可选链、空值合并、顶级await等特性,并推进记录与元组、装饰器等提案,开发者可通过GitHub跟踪进展并用Babel实验新功能。
    624
  • 幻影之瞳

    幻影之瞳

    2025-12-02 18:20:03
    JavaScript代理模式_javascript设计思想
    代理模式是通过创建代理对象控制对原对象的访问,可在不修改原对象的情况下增强功能。1.使用ES6Proxy可拦截属性读取、赋值等操作;2.典型应用包括数据校验、缓存懒加载、访问控制和日志监控;3.体现开闭原则与关注点分离,提升代码可维护性与扩展性。
    407
  • 幻影之瞳

    幻影之瞳

    2025-12-02 18:52:02
    代码分割与懒加载策略_使用动态import提升性能
    动态import是指通过import()语法在运行时按需加载模块,与静态import立即加载不同,它返回Promise,支持代码分割与懒加载。结合React.lazy可实现路由级分割,用户访问时才加载对应组件;也可用于条件性加载重功能,如点击触发或空闲预加载。构建工具如Webpack、Vite原生支持,需配置chunk分割、命名及魔法注释优化管理。合理使用可显著减少首屏体积,提升加载性能。
    939
  • 幻影之瞳

    幻影之瞳

    2025-12-02 19:26:41
    前端缓存策略_javascript存储管理
    前端缓存通过提升加载速度、减少请求来优化体验。1.localStorage适合持久化用户设置;2.sessionStorage用于会话级临时数据;3.IndexedDB支持大容量结构化存储;4.CacheAPI缓存静态资源,配合ServiceWorker实现离线访问;5.内存缓存适用于高频读取数据。设计时应根据数据特性选择层级,静态资源用CacheAPI版本化,接口数据优先内存缓存再落盘,敏感信息避免明文存localStorage。需设置过期时间、监听storage事件同步状态、定期清理过期项、
    804
  • 幻影之瞳

    幻影之瞳

    2025-12-02 19:40:02
    JavaScript动画实现_javascript视觉效果
    JavaScript动画通过动态修改样式属性实现视觉效果,核心是使用requestAnimationFrame优化渲染,1.利用rAF创建流畅动画,如递归调用step函数控制元素位移;2.实现淡入淡出与缩放,通过逐步调整opacity或transform属性达成基础动效;3.引入缓动函数模拟真实运动,如用数学公式控制减速移动提升自然感;4.支持多元素序列动画与交互响应,可遍历元素并绑定事件实现鼠标触发的节奏化动画。
    616

最新下载

更多>
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号